Video: Man dresses up as a rabbit to greet traffic every month

A mysterious giant white rabbit stands on a bridge at the start of every month to wave at passing motorists.

The 6ft tall unusual sight, intended to bring people joy and luck, is dressed in a colourful waistcoat and scarf, waving and making the peace sign at passing vehicles.

After spotting the bunny in Barnes, west London, passerby Sarah Travers tweeted: “What on earth was this white rabbit doing at 8am this morning on the terrace?”

The rabbit is in fact a project by a performance artist called Spike McLarrity who started popping up at Barnes bridge in November last year.

He said: “Happy first of the month. Some nice interactions this morning, one woman came up and wanted a photograph as no one believed her last month when she saw me, and a gent with his dog got me to hold his dog.

“Take time to breath, enjoy the beauty of the misty days, the unknown, the adventure that awaits you every day throughout this month of November.”
